Ipanahalli

Ipanahalli is a village located in Krishnarajpet taluka of Mandya district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 23km away from sub-district headquarter Krishnarajapet (tehsildar office) and 80km away from district headquarter Mandya. As per 2009 stats, Alambadi Kaval is the gram panchayat of Ipanahalli village.

About Ipanahalli

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ipanahalli is 613617. The village spans a total geographical area of 303.13 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 571605. Krishnarajpet is nearest town to Ipanahalli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.

Population of Ipanahalli

Below is a concise population overview of Ipanahalli as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 792 405 387
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 107 64 43
Scheduled Castes (SC) 118 60 58
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 449 269 180
Illiterate Population 343 136 207

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ipanahalli village:

  • The total population of Ipanahalli village is around 792, including approximately 405 males and 387 females, with a sex ratio of 955 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 107 children aged 0–6 years in Ipanahalli village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Ipanahalli village has 118 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Ipanahalli village is about 56.69%, with male literacy at 66.42% and female literacy at 46.51%.
  • There are around 193 households in Ipanahalli village.

Connectivity of Ipanahalli

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ipanahalli. As per the 2011 stats, Ipanahalli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
